FRISCO, Texas – The No. 11 Texas A&M Aggies used five pitchers to grind out a 5-4 victory over the Baylor Bears at Dr Pepper Ballpark Saturday, moving to 1-1 at the Frisco College Baseball Classic.
A Frisco Classic record of 10,254 watched Texas A&M improve to 10-1 on the year.
Chandler Jozwiak labored through 2.1 scoreless innings, scattering two hits and three walks while striking out two. John Doxakis followed with 2.1 innings of work, allowing one run on two hits and three walks. Nolan Hoffman (2-0) picked up the win, allowing one unearned run on one hit and one walk while striking out three. Cason Sherrod was cruising before yielding a two-run home run in the ninth. He finished with two runs on three hits and one walk. Kaylor Chafin picked up his first save of the season, working around a hit and a walk.
The crafty A&M pitching staff stranded 17 baserunners on the day.
The Aggies' 7-8-9 hitters accounted for five of the Aggies' eight hits and two home runs. Will Frizzell hit his first career dinger, going 2-for-3 with two runs and one RBI. Cole Bedford batted 1-for-2 with a solo home run and a sacrifice bunt. Allonte Wingate batted 2-for-3 with one run and one RBI.
SCORING SUMMARY
B3 | Bedford drove a 1-1 offering over the leftfield wall for leadoff home run. A&M 1, BU 0.
T5 | Cole Haring started the frame with a single up the middle and moved to second on Davion Downey's sacrifice bunt. A grounder by Shea Langaliers moved Haring to third and he scored on a double down the rightfield line by Davis Wendzel. A&M 1, BU 1.
B5 | Hunter Coleman reached on a five-pitch walk to lead off the inning. Frizzell followed with a single up the middle and Bedford pushed both runners into scoring position with a sacrifice bunt. Wingate blooped a single to rightfield, knocking in Coleman and Frizzell came home to score on a passed ball. A&M 3, BU 1.
T7 | Wendzel reached on an error by Wingate at third base to get things start. Andy Thomas singled to leftfield and Nick Loftin reached on a bunt single down the third base line to load the bases. Sherrod relieved Hoffman on the mound and got the first batter he faced, Josh Bissonette, to ground into a 4-6-3 double play with Wendzel coming home to score. Baylor would reload the bases, but Haring grounded out to short to end the rally. A&M 3, BU 2.
B7 | Frizzell launched a leadoff dinger to rightfield. With one out, Wingate singled through the right side of the infield and moved to third on a groundout by Zach DeLoach. Michael Helman knocked in Wingate with a single to leftfield. A&M 5, BU 2.
T9 | Loftin caused ruckus, singling to rightfield and moving to second on wild pitch. Sherrod yielded a home run to leftfield by Bissonette, cutting the Aggie lead to one. Chafin entered the game and gave up a bloop single to centerfield by Richard Cunningham. Baylor sacrificed the runner to second base, but Haring whiffed on three pitches for the second out. Tucker Johnson drew a pinch-hit walk, to put the go-ahead run at first, but Chafin got Langeliers to ground out on the first offering from Chafin to end the game.

TEXAS A&M QUOTES
Head Coach Rob Childress
On getting the bounce back win...
"Obviously we didn't want to give up all the walks today, but I was proud of how we battled. Both teams were fighting hard to get a win after disappointing losses yesterday. It was great to pull out this win in front of a great crowd. It was a terrific atmosphere tonight. A regional type atmosphere.
On the pitching for Sunday...
"We emptied the tank today on the mound. We'll need Mitchell (Kilkenny) to give us some length tomorrow and some young guys will be counted on out of the bullpen."
On what Allonte Wingate brings to the team...
"He was a late addition in the summer and we are very fortunate to get him. He's a player who is willing to do anything for the team. He gives us a lot of versatility both in the field and at the plate."
On Will Frizzell's play as a freshman...
"Like Zach (DeLoach), he's very advanced for a freshman. He is very patient at the plate and willing to talk his walks. Very mature for a freshman."
Junior catcher Cole Bedford
On putting down a sac bunt one plate appearance after hitting a home run...
"I'll do whatever the team needs me to do. In a way, the bunt is much more satisfying than the home run. It set up two runs. The home run was just a solo shot."
Senior pitcher Kaylor Chafin
On what he did after Friday's tough outing...
"I just tried to get away from baseball. I was around Mitchell (Kilkenny) most of the day and we pretty much talked about anything but baseball. I came to the field today with the mindset I had last year. I want the ball when the team needs outs."
